如何确保个人服务器抵御网络攻击?

在互联网的广泛普及下,个人服务器成为了众多用户关注的焦点。然而,它们也面临着DDoS攻击、暴力破解和恶意软件等网络威胁。为了确保个人服务器的安全,采取有效的防护措施显得尤为关键。本文将介绍如何通过加强系统安全、设置防火墙、定期更新和备份等方法,来保护个人服务器不受网络攻击的侵害。

如何确保个人服务器抵御网络攻击?插图

  1. 识别网络攻击的类型

在制定防护策略前,识别可能遇到的网络攻击类型至关重要。主要攻击类型包括:

  • DDoS攻击:通过海量请求使服务器无法处理合法用户请求。
  • 暴力破解:尝试通过自动化工具猜测账户凭证。
  • 恶意软件:利用病毒、木马等手段破坏系统或盗取数据。
  1. 加强系统安全 2.1 使用复杂密码 使用包含字母、数字和特殊符号的强密码,并定期更新。

2.2 限制登录尝试次数 通过系统配置限制失败的登录尝试,如使用fail2ban等工具封禁多次失败的IP。

  1. 设置防火墙 3.1 软件防火墙 利用iptables或UFW等软件防火墙设置流量规则。

3.2 硬件防火墙 如果可能,使用硬件防火墙作为额外的安全层。

  1. 定期更新和维护 4.1 更新操作系统和应用程序 保持系统和软件的最新状态,及时应用安全补丁。

4.2 进行安全审计 定期检查服务器配置和权限,修复潜在的安全漏洞。

  1. 数据备份策略 5.1 定期备份数据 实施全量和增量备份,确保数据的可恢复性。

5.2 安全存储备份 将备份数据存放在安全的位置,避免与主服务器共用存储空间。

  1. 使用安全协议 6.1 SSH加密连接 使用SSH替代不安全的Telnet进行远程管理。

6.2 HTTPS加密通信 为网站启用SSL证书,确保数据传输的加密。

  1. 监控与响应机制 7.1 实时监控 利用Nagios、Zabbix等工具监控服务器状态。

7.2 应急响应计划 制定针对不同攻击的应急响应流程。

如何确保个人服务器抵御网络攻击?插图1

  1. 总结

保护个人服务器的安全是一个持续的过程,需要综合考虑多种安全措施。从加强系统安全到设置防火墙,再到定期更新、备份和使用安全协议,这些措施的全面实施对于提高服务器的安全性至关重要。同时,建立有效的监控和应急响应机制,是确保服务器长期稳定运行的关键。在网络威胁不断增加的今天,提升安全意识和技能是服务器管理员的重要任务。

THE END